Explore Falls Park

This urban paradise is a beautiful environment in the middle of the city, and it’s one of the greatest things to do in Greenville. It has acres of beautiful countryside that is conveniently accessible for peaceful exploring. Falls Park has gardens, walking routes, waterfalls, and art pieces. It is also the location of the Liberty Bridge, an individual floating bridge over 300 feet in length and the only one of its type in the Western Hemisphere. It has some of the nicest views in town. Stroll along the Swamp Rabbit Trail

The Swamp Rabbit track is a 22-mile track beside the Reedy River and is ideal for biking, running, or strolling. Rent a bicycle from any of Greenville’s numerous bike stalls and ride on a gorgeous, sunny day in South Carolina. Consider parking opposite the river near the Swamp River Cafe along Grocery, getting something to eat, and then renting a bike at the bike rack on the rear border of the diner’s property.

Greenville County Art Museum

The Greenville County Museum of Art provides a comprehensive look at life in the South beginning with the colonial era. As a result, it is regarded as the top venue of its sort in this region of the nation. The structure itself is a piece of beauty, and it is refreshingly contemporary. They exhibit diverse styles and materials, ranging from impressionism to abstraction. There is much to enjoy about the museum, which is located on the city’s gorgeous art and cultural complex, Heritage Green.
